#3d4429 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3d4429 is composed of 23.9% red, 26.7%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 39.7% yellow and 73.3% black. It has a hue angle of 75.6 degrees, a saturation of 24.8% and a lightness of 21.4%. #3d4429 color hex could be obtained by blending #7a8852 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#3d4429 color description : Very dark desaturated green.
#3d4429 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3d4429 has RGB values of R:61, G:68,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0, Y:0.4,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 4015145.

Shades and Tints of #3d4429
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060704 is the darkest color, while #fbfc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#3d4429
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#373736 is the less saturated color, while #4f6a03 is the most saturated one.
